10 CorrectCoder for Edits Book 2014 CorrectCoder for Unbundling contains over 900,000 Surgical, Radiology, Laboratory and E&M unbundling alerts. The Correct Coding Initiative is not just for Medicare! CCI is a tool used by private payers to determine appropriate billing of CPT codes and HCPCS codes. This spiral bound book incorporates all code changes instituted by CMS and represents the most up-to-date compilation of correct coding edits and mutually exclusive codes in a comprehensive yet easy-to-use format. Using the most recent coding edits insures you will receive full and appropriate reimbursement for the medical services you provide and reduces your audit exposure. 17 Medicare RBRVS 2014: The Physicians Guide The 23rd edition of this concise, authoritative text provides detailed background information on new 2014 Medicare payment rules and how they may affect the physician practice. This reference offers valuable insight and tools needed to understand the resource-based relative value scale (RBRVS) system. This invaluable reference will help health care professionals more accurately calculate payment schedules.
